I was talking to a colleague whose wife taught an intro to computing class back in the mid 80’s. He told me this story:

“My wife came to class the first night of the semester and there was a tech guy who was just finishing up modifying the computers in the classroom. He told my wife the all the computers had hard drives in them now. She won’t have to use the floppy disk drive anymore.”

So far, so good.

“He told her to use the C drive, not the A drive from now on. My wife always had the students bring a blank floppy disk to class and she taught them how to format the disk.”

Oh, no! I could see where this was headed.

“So she had the whole class format the C drive at the same time. Can you believe the tech didn’t warn her?”

I managed to keep a straight face during this, but I also was thinking “was the tech privy to her lesson plan?” And also, “she’s the teacher for a computer use class; she’s supposed to know these things… or at least ask if there’s doubt.”
